How the Paintless Dent Removal Process Works

First, the specialist inspects the dent to determine if paintless dent removal is suitable. Factors such as the dent’s depth, sharpness, and proximity to panel edges influence this decision. For example, horizontal crease dents or vertical crease dents often require delicate manipulation to avoid stretching the metal. Once suitability is confirmed, the specialist accesses the dent from behind the panel, using specialised rods and tools to apply controlled pressure. This technique gradually pushes the dent outwards, restoring the panel’s original shape without the need for repainting.

In cases where dents are caused by hail damage or vandal damage, the process remains similar but may involve treating multiple small dents across the vehicle’s surface. The specialist’s skill in recognising subtle variations in metal tension is key to achieving a smooth finish. If the paint is cracked or the dent is too deep, traditional bodyshop repairs might be recommended instead.

When Paintless Dent Removal May Not Be Suitable

While paintless dent removal offers many benefits, it is not always the best solution. Dents with cracked or chipped paint, very deep indentations, or those located on panel edges may require traditional bodyshop repairs. Specialists also consider the accessibility of the dent; some panels have limited space behind them, making it difficult to reach the damaged area with PDR tools.

In cases of severe vandal damage dents or large golf ball dents, the repair cost and complexity might increase, and repainting could be necessary to fully restore the vehicle’s appearance. Honest assessment during the initial inspection helps set realistic expectations and ensures the chosen repair method delivers the best outcome.

Understanding Paintless Dent Removal Benefits

One of the main advantages of paintless dent removal is preserving the original paint finish, which maintains your vehicle’s factory look and resale value. The process is typically quicker than traditional repairs, often completed within a few hours depending on the dent’s size and location. Additionally, PDR is environmentally friendly, as it avoids the use of fillers, paints, and solvents.
